1. The Art of Portrait Photography

Portrait photography is an art form that goes beyond mere documentation. It is a medium through which photographers are able to connect with their subjects and convey their story. A good portrait photograph has the power to evoke emotions, tell a narrative, and reveal the true essence of the person being captured. It is a delicate balance between technical skill and artistic vision, requiring the photographer to have a keen eye for detail and an ability to establish rapport with their subjects.

3. Finding Your Perfect Match

When it comes to choosing a portrait photographer, it is important to find someone who aligns with your own personal style and vision. Each photographer has their own unique approach and aesthetic, so it is crucial to do your research and find someone whose work resonates with you. Look through their portfolio, read reviews, and reach out for a consultation. This will give you a chance to discuss your ideas and ensure that you are on the same page before embarking on the photoshoot.
